Gett

Why has the average rating for Gett's VIP taxi service declined from 4.8 to 4.2 stars over the past quarter?

Introduction

The decline in Gett's VIP taxi service rating from 4.8 to 4.2 stars over the past quarter is a significant issue that requires immediate attention. This drop could indicate underlying problems affecting user satisfaction and potentially impact the service's reputation and market position. I'll approach this analysis systematically, focusing on identifying the root cause, validating hypotheses, and developing both short-term and long-term solutions.

Framework overview

This analysis follows a structured approach covering issue identification, hypothesis generation, validation, and solution development.

Step 1

Clarifying Questions (3 minutes)

  • Looking at the timing, I'm thinking there might be seasonal factors at play. Has there been any significant change in demand or usage patterns during this quarter compared to previous years?

Why it matters: Seasonal variations could explain temporary rating fluctuations. Expected answer: No significant seasonal changes observed. Impact on approach: If confirmed, we'd focus more on internal factors.

  • Considering the specificity of the VIP service, I'm wondering about any recent changes to the offering. Have there been any modifications to the VIP service features or pricing in the last quarter?

Why it matters: Changes in service offerings often impact user satisfaction. Expected answer: A slight price increase was implemented. Impact on approach: We'd need to analyze the price elasticity of demand and user perception.

  • Given the substantial drop, I'm curious about the distribution of ratings. Has there been a shift in the proportion of 1-star or 5-star ratings?

Why it matters: This could indicate whether the issue affects all users equally or a specific segment. Expected answer: An increase in 3-star ratings and decrease in 5-star ratings. Impact on approach: We'd focus on understanding why previously satisfied users are now less enthusiastic.

  • Thinking about potential technical issues, have there been any significant changes to the app or backend systems supporting the VIP service?

Why it matters: Technical problems can directly impact user experience and ratings. Expected answer: A new app version was released at the start of the quarter. Impact on approach: We'd prioritize investigating potential bugs or UX issues in the new version.
